Senate Appropriators Want Air Force Acquisition Strategy for ABMS

A report on the Senate Appropriations Committee's (SAC) fiscal 2021 defense appropriations bill asks the U.S. Air Force to submit an acquisition strategy early next year for the Advanced Battle Management System (ABMS). While the Air Force fiscal 2021 budget requested $302.3 million for ABMS, Senate appropriators recommended about $208.8 million--$93.5 million less than the request, but an increase of nearly $51 million from the fiscal 2020 appropriated amount.
